got this from their website
Target price match price exclusions:- Clearance, closeout, damaged product, used, refurbished, open packages or liquidation sales.
- Prices advertised only as a percent off or dollar off.
- Paid membership club or paid loyalty programs (e.g. prices that require a club or loyalty card that is associated with a membership fee).
- Free product promotions, buy one, get one, bundled offers, or special purchases if the retail price is not shown in the advertisement.
- Competitor coupon-required, including mobile coupons.
- Competitor price matches on items where Target or the competitor is offering a free gift card.
- Mail-in offers or instant rebates.
- Sales tax promotions.
- Offers that include financing.
